      1. Real-Time MLS Monitoring
        Staying updated is crucial in real estate. The software proactively scans the MLS, seeking properties that fit your criteria. The Multiple Listing Service (MLS) is a comprehensive database real estate professionals use to list and browse properties for sale. It provides detailed information about listings, ensuring realtors and potential buyers can access current and accurate property data. Whether it’s about the price, location, number of bedrooms, or specific features like a pool or solar panels, this software ensures you’re always in the loop.

    Financing Options for Real Estate Investors

    Having the right tools to identify a stellar investment property is just the beginning. Equally vital is understanding how to finance your acquisition. Fortunately for real estate investors, working with JVM Lending guarantees there are a range of financing options tailored to each investor’s unique needs:

    1.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R) Loans: This type of loan focuses on the property’s cash flow rather than the borrower’s personal income. JVM will assess the DSCR, which is the monthly rent divided by the monthly loan payment. A ratio greater than 1 indicates the property generates sufficient income to cover its expenses, making it an attractive option for investors focusing on rental income properties.
    2. Bank Statement Loans: Traditional loans often require W-2s or tax returns, but what if you’re self-employed and have variable income? That is where Bank Statement Loans can help. Instead of traditional income documentation, JVM Lending can analyze deposits in your bank account to determine your eligibility and loan terms. These are an excellent option for investors with significant cash flows but varying income structures.
    3. Conventional Financing: The tried-and-true method for many investors, conventional loans are not backed by the government and typically require a 20% down payment. While they may have stricter credit requirements, they often come with competitive interest rates and can be used for primary residences, second homes, or rental properties.

    Remember, each financing option has pros and cons, and the best choice depends on your individual circumstances, investment goals, and financial profile.     Where to Start: Understanding the Arizona Real Estate Landscape

    Arizona, often recognized for its deserts, cacti, and stunning sunsets, is also home to a vibrant and dynamic real estate market. The state presents numerous real estate opportunities, from the urban allure of Phoenix, with its rising skyscrapers and bustling nightlife, to the serene landscapes of Sedona, a haven for luxury retreats.

    Key Regions:

    • Phoenix Metro Area: Often termed the Valley of the Sun, this region is experiencing a surge in both residential and commercial properties. The influx of tech companies and startups has increased demand in both sectors.
    • Tucson: Known for its university-driven real estate demand, Tucson has seen a rise in rental properties catering to students and staff.
    • Flagstaff: A favorite among those seeking cooler climates and mountain vistas, Flagstaff’s real estate market is characterized by vacation homes and retreats.

    Current Trends:

    • There’s a noticeable shift towards sustainable and eco-friendly homes, driven by a more environmentally conscious clientele. This can mean premiums are paid for homes with solar and other green enhancements.
    • Gated communities with amenities are seeing a surge in popularity among families and retirees.
    • There’s a rising demand for properties with home offices, driven by the remote work culture.

    Challenges and Opportunities: The increasing demand in Arizona’s real estate brings challenges like rising property prices and competition. However, this also means there is robust demand in the rental market. With a diverse landscape, there are many opportunities to accommodate any rental strategy, from luxury condos to sprawling ranches and everything in between.
